How long do stickers last?
The lifespan of a sticker depends on the material and where it's placed. Vinyl stickers with adhesive can last up to 5 years, while cling stickers typically last up to 6 months. Specialty materials like glow-in-the-dark vinyl are not meant for long-term outdoor use but can last indoors for up to 5 years. Perforated film, designed for one-way visibility, will last up to 3 years.

What is a die cut sticker?
Die cut stickers are custom stickers precisely cut around your artwork, giving the design its own unique shape. This creates a more polished and professional appearance compared to standard-cut stickers or decals. Die cut stickers are highly customizable and are especially popular among business owners for branding and promotional purposes.
How thick are your stickers?
Our stickers come in a variety of thicknesses based on material type and lamination options. Please see the table below to find the thickness of the sticker material you are looking for. We have included the thickness of the sticker alone as well as when it is still secured to the backing.
Sticker Material Thickness
Sticker Material | Thickness of Sticker | Thickness of Sticker with Backing |
---|---|---|
White Cling | 4.33 mil | 8.27 mil |
Clear Vinyl | 4.33 mil | 8.27 mil |
Front-Facing Cling | 4.33 mil | 8.27 mil |
Reflective Vinyl | 11.8 mil | 17.7 mil |
Permanent Adhesive | 4.33 mil | 8.66 mil |
White Vinyl (Most Popular) | 4.33 mil | 8.27 mil |
Glow in the Dark Vinyl | 13.0 mil | 18.9 mil |
Front-Facing Adhesive | 4.33 mil | 8.27 mil |
Perforated Film | 6.7 mil | 12.6 mil |
Clear Cling | 4.33 mil | 8.27 mil |

What is sticker lamination?
Lamination is a process that adds a protective layer to your sticker, enhancing its durability, strength, and appearance. At CarStickers.com, we apply a laminate layer to our printed stickers to make them scratch-resistant, weatherproof, and more resilient to UV rays. This extra layer can extend the life of your sticker by 1-3 years and comes at no additional cost. Lamination also allows you to choose between a glossy or matte finish, giving your stickers the perfect look.

How are stickers measured and priced?
At Carstickers.com, we measure and price all our stickers based on square inches. To calculate the square inches of a sticker, simply multiply the width by the height. For example, a sticker that is 4�W x 4�H (4 inches wide and 4 inches high) and a sticker that is 2�W x 8�H (2 inches wide and 8 inches high) will cost the same because both are 16 square inches.
These measurements are based on the widest and tallest areas of the sticker's shape, measured from left to right and top to bottom in a straight line.
Please note: The measurements are taken when the design is upright and in the same position as it will be applied. This ensures that the sticker you order will fit in the intended space. For example, while a diamond-shaped sticker could theoretically be rotated 45 degrees and measured as a square, a 3�x3� diamond and a 3�x3� square rotated 45 degrees are not the same size and will not fit in the same space.
